Bio

I am represented by Lynette Eason of the Steve Laube Agency. My debut three book series releases with Kregel Publications this year! I’m so excited to see where these next steps take us! I hope my books provide adventure and escape, a love story you’ll remember, and reminders of grace and hope.
When I was in eighth grade, a teacher handed me a school library copy of a Janette Oke book. Since then, I’ve been a voracious reader of inspirational fiction. While I read in several genres, love stories amidst a suspenseful plot own my heart. It is humbling and amazing to enter into a genre filled with so many wonderful authors.
I grew up in Southwest Colorado, then transplanted to Southern California for college. I earned a degree in Communication Studies from Biola University, then a Master’s in Leadership and Organizational Studies from Azusa Pacific University. After spending most of my career in sales, I now get to work with my husband part time and mom to my three boys full time! We live in the slow, open space of California’s central coast. When I’m not writing, sending long Marco Polos to friends, or podcasting on TheLitLadies Podcast, I enjoy boating, camping, running, and anything else outside.
